1. Team Leadership & People Development
• Allocate workloads, conduct regular performance reviews, coaching, and plan capability development for each member
• Standardize pricing processes, data accuracy, and performance discipline within the team.
• Ensure effective coordination between the Pricing team and other departments (Booking, CS, Sales…)
2. Strategic Pricing Management
• Develop and implement regional pricing strategies for US, Canada(TP)/ other route (nonTP)
• Worked closely with the pricing HQ team and Trade Managers to ensure strategic pricing alignment and strengthen the competitiveness of market offerings.
• Monitor market trends, freight movements, and competitor pricing to make proactive adjustments.
• Provide strategic recommendations to upper management regarding pricing, margin control, and market opportunities.
3. Carrier & Vendor Management
• Build and maintain strong partnerships with shipping lines, NVOCCs, and vendors.
• Negotiate rates/space with shipping lines to secure competitive pricing that meets customer needs
• Escalate key issues with shipping lines and drive improved support for major accounts.
4. Pricing Operations
• Monitor and maintain accurate pricing data and rate sheets in the system.
• Monitor fully calculation cost structures while ensuring pricing accuracy in contract.
• Optimize pricing workflow to reduce turnaround time and improve efficiency.
• Work closely with Booking, CS to ensure space availability and pricing compliance.
• Support related department about explaining or solving issues related to pricing.
• Prepare weekly/monthly pricing performance reports with insights and recommendations.
• Analyze pricing profitability, discount structures, win/loss data, and market share.
